#874918 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#874918 is composed of 52.9% red, 28.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 31.2%. #874918 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9230 with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#874918 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#874918 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#874918 has RGB values of R:135, G:73,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.82,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8866072.

Shades and Tints of #874918

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#874918

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504f4f is the less saturated color, while #994706 is the most saturated one.
